CI note for reviewers: the Fernwick export job now retries failed uploads up to three times with exponential backoff before marking the pipeline red. Previously a single transient timeout failed the whole run, which is why you saw flaky nightly builds last week. If a retry succeeds, the run is green but logs a warning you should still skim. The fix landed in the nightly pipeline; the relevant build token is below.

session token of tajef-bageg = htk21_5d90d574934f3ccae6437

Ticket: Brambot config has drifted again

So the stale-branch cleanup bot (Brambot) on the Copperfen repos is behaving differently per instance again. Someone bumped the age threshold on one deployment to stop it deleting the Larkhill release branches, which was fair, but now the other instances still run the old aggressive settings and nobody wrote any of it down. Future maintainers: please reconcile these and commit them properly. For the record, here's what the drifted instance is currently running.

deployment values, tafof-taduf:
pelius:
  pin: 6508
  tenant: praiel
  seal: seal_4e33a2f4
  metrics_host: metrics.pelius.plorvagrid.corp
  standby_team: druix
  escalation: juldor-norius
  nonce: 5db598

Subject: Scheduled rotation of the Digestly batch key

Hello everyone,

As part of our quarterly security cycle, the key used by the Digestly scheduler — the service that assembles and queues the nightly email digest batches — has been rotated. Please note that the old key stops working at end of day, and any digest runs configured locally will fail with an auth error until updated. Update your configuration carefully and verify with a dry run. The new key follows.

gateway credential: kto23_LX9A4ys6i4nzHtpOLNLodKK

### Step 4 — Deploy SproutClock

Build the scheduler image from the tagged commit. Run the smoke suite; all watering-interval tests must pass. Push to the Greenrow staging registry only after signature checks succeed. No manual edits to the cron manifests. Confirm the artifact digest matches the release notes. Sign the manifest using the deploy key below.

signing key of bagap-yawep = bky13_TbfT6ZMUoGJo2